polycentric

/ˌpɑliˈsɛntrɪk/
adjective
  1. Having more than one center of power, authority, or activity.
    • A polycentric city has several downtown areas rather than just one main center.
    • Polycentric management allows local offices to make their own choices.
    • The European Union is a polycentric system with multiple decision-making bodies.
